Oracle to podcast from OpenWorld

By Warwick Ashford, ITWeb London correspondent
Johannesburg, 12 Sept 2005

Attendees of the Oracle OpenWorld event that opens in San Francisco this weekend will be able to download news and information from daily podcasts, as well as access live content from Oracle, PeopleSoft and JD Edwards at one venue.

The Oracle OpenWorld podcasts, from 17 to 22 September at the Moscone Centre, will deliver news and information about daily themes, enabling attendees to download and store content for future use.

Oracle is one of the first companies to bring podcasting to a conference to provide reference material for attendees as well as reach audiences who may not have been able to attend, says Judy Sim, the company`s senior worldwide marketing VP.

The OracleWorld initiative is an extension of the podcasts already available on the Oracle Technology Network Web site, aimed at developers and database administrators.

About 80 South African Oracle partners and customers are to attend OracleWorld 2005, which will feature a presentation by Johannesburg-based Oracle partner, iFactory.

iFactory subsidiary, mobileObsession, is to debut its m-business solution on the international stage in the hopes of attracting customers as well as distributors among other Oracle partners.

"OpenWorld will be an ideal opportunity to engage with Oracle partners from around the world and canvass for support," says Tony Forbes, iFactory CEO.
